The OpenROAD MCP Server is a Model Context Protocol server that facilitates interaction with OpenROAD and OpenROAD Flow Scripts (ORFS) through persistent sessions and command management.
From the registry: The OpenROAD MCP server - interactive EDA sessions via Model Context Protocol

$ curl -LsSf https://astral.sh/uv/install.sh | shPlease install the `openroad-mcp` MCP server into my current AI client (that's you).
Required prerequisites (do these first if not already done):
- **OpenROAD** — OpenROAD must be installed and available in PATH. (https://openroad.readthedocs.io/en/latest/main/GettingStarted.html)
- **Python 3.13+ and uv** — Python 3.13+ and the uv package manager. Run: `curl -LsSf https://astral.sh/uv/install.sh | sh`
Canonical MCP server config (stdio transport):
- command: `uvx`
- args: ["--from","git+https://github.com/luarss/openroad-mcp","openroad-mcp"]
Note: EDA/chip design tool for RTL-to-GDS flows. Supports interactive OpenROAD sessions with persistent state.
Add this MCP server to my current client's config in the correct format for you. If you need secrets or credentials I haven't provided, ASK me — do not invent values or leave raw placeholders. After adding it, tell me how to verify the server is connected.Manage UniFi Protect cameras, events, recordings, and smart detections via MCP.